Tissue engineering stands as a pivotal frontier in biomedical research, heralding a paradigm shift in healthcare solutions. Its profound impact resonates across diverse domains, from facilitating breakthroughs in regenerative medicine to driving transformative advancements in medical technology. As the convergence of biology, engineering, and materials science, tissue engineering holds the promise of repairing and regenerating damaged tissues and organs, addressing unmet medical needs. This burgeoning field not only fuels scientific exploration but also catalyzes business development by fostering innovation in biotechnology, pharmaceuticals, and medical devices. Tissue engineering is a growing market with a high demand for organ and tissue transplantation, especially for skin, bone, cartilage, and cardiac tissues. The field also has great potential for developing novel therapies and technologies for regenerative medicine. Our tissue engineering services include biomedical implant design and customization, biodegradation and other performance testing, and biosafety testing in vitro and in vivo.
